Understanding Rolex Watches Price in Oman
The price of a Rolex in Oman depends primarily on the collection and configuration. For example, the Oyster Perpetual is one of the more accessible Rolex collections, with current Oman retail listings showing Oystersteel models starting around OMR 2,600 and rising according to case size and materials. The Datejust collection is positioned at a higher range, with current Oman listings showing Oystersteel versions from approximately OMR 3,350 to OMR 3,800 depending on size and configuration.
Precious-metal models are significantly more expensive. Gold, platinum, and diamond-set configurations can reach many thousands of Omani rials because of the materials, craftsmanship, and additional detailing used in their construction.

New Rolex Watches and Pre-Owned Prices
One of the most important factors when researching Rolex watches price in Oman is whether the watch is new or pre-owned. A brand-new Rolex purchased through an authorized retailer generally has an official retail price, while pre-owned watches are priced according to condition, age, reference number, accessories, rarity, and market demand.
Online secondary-market listings demonstrate the wide variation in prices. Why Rolex Prices Differ So Much
Rolex pricing is influenced by several factors. Stainless-steel watches are generally less expensive than watches made from yellow gold, white gold, Everose gold, or platinum. Diamond-set models can command substantially higher prices because of the additional gemstones and craftsmanship.
Model popularity also has a major effect on secondary-market prices. Certain sports models can trade above their official retail prices because demand is higher than immediate availability. Choosing the Right Rolex in Oman
Before purchasing a Rolex, buyers should consider their budget, preferred style, intended use, and whether they want a new or pre-owned watch. A classic Oyster Perpetual may be appropriate for someone seeking a versatile luxury watch, while a Datejust offers a more traditional and recognizable Rolex design. Buyers looking for a professional sports watch may prefer the Submariner or GMT-Master II.
It is also important to compare the exact reference number rather than comparing only collection names. Two watches from the same Rolex family can have very different prices because of differences in size, metal, bezel, dial, bracelet, and gemstone setting.
